Hi all,
I have a 99 classic with a factory alarm. The type with a single button key fob and a small keypad box wired into the car you can use should something go wrong. My problem is that everytime I open the car doors or set/disarm the alarm it beeps like mad and very loud. This wouldnt normaly be a problem but I work nights and when I get in at stupid o'clock you can hear it for miles around! The neighbours have had enough of it and so have I. Short of taking it all out, does anyone know how I can get it to stay silent unless someone breaks into it?

You can program the problem out as it is illegal in the uk,try scoobypedia i think you can download the manual from there.(sigma m30 alarm)
